/* CSS Document */

body {

/*background: url(sic.jpg) no-repeat white fixed center top;*/
font-size:14px;
color:black;
font-family: Trebuchet MS, verdana;

}


/*.header {
 background-image: url(sic1.jpg);
 background-position: top center;
 background-color:transparent;
 background-repeat:no-repeat;

font-family: Trebuchet MS, verdana;
font-size:35px;
color:black;
padding-left:150px;
padding-top:20px;
border: 1px solid #981c1e;
height:135px;
width:780px;
}
*/

.tabella {
width:100%;
height:98%;
}

.menu {
background-color:transparent;
font-family: Trebuchet MS, verdana;
font-size:18px;
height:95%;
width:25%;
}

.contenuto {
width:75%;
height:95%;
}

.footer {
background-color: silver; 
height:;
font-family: Trebuchet MS, verdana;
font-size:12px;
color:black;
padding-left:-50px;
text-align:center;
}

.home {
font-family: Trebuchet MS, verdana;
font-size:16px;
}

.home2 {
font-family: Trebuchet MS, verdana;
font-size:15px;
}


.voci {
color:black;
font-weight:thin;
background-color:silver;
border: 1px solid #981c1e;
width: 200px;
height: 22px;
text-align:;
}



p.voci:hover, p.home:hover, p.card:hover {
background-color:white;
width: 200px;

}

 a {
color:black;
text-decoration: none;
}

a:hover {
color: ;
}

.immagini {
width: 100px;
height: 100px;
border: 1px solid gray;
}

input {
border: 1px solid black;
}

textarea {
border: 1px solid black;
}